The first day of the local campaign period in Central Luzon on March 28 concluded without any reported incidents, the Police Regional Office III (PRO-3) said.

Brigadier General Jean Fajardo, PRO-3 director, said the start of the campaign period was generally peaceful.

She expressed hope that the situation will remain the same until the election day on May 12, 2025.

Fajardo said law enforcement agencies will continue to implement security measures.

The Commission on Elections and Philippine National Police conduct checkpoints, OPLAN Sita, and Simulation Exercises, to ensure public safety, she added.

“The Philippine National Police, alongside our partner agencies, is fully committed to providing the highest level of security to guarantee a safe, orderly, honest, and peaceful election on May 12,” Fajardo said.

She added that the PNP continues to monitor election-related activities and enforce security protocols to maintain order throughout the election period.
